there are some decent write ups out there, but the general concensus is that if you have never done it before leave it to someone else. Just taking a dremel to your heads could actually make them worse.

the eazyest thing to do is on the exhaust port is grond down smooth the hump and the smooth the entire port w/ a sanding roll, then on the chambers smooth everything out and grind down any bumps but becareful here.....and last try yo gasket match the intake and exhaust ports.....good luck
